How Long Does a Commercial Rooftop Unit Last?
Most commercial rooftop units last 15-20 years, with ASHRAE's median at 15. Learn what drives RTU lifespan in DFW's demanding climate.
What Is the $5,000 Rule for HVAC? A Repair-or-Replace Guide
The $5,000 rule for HVAC helps you decide repair or replace: multiply unit age by repair cost. Over $5,000? Replacement usually wins. Under? Repair may.
Commercial vs Residential HVAC: What Is the Difference?
The difference between commercial and residential HVAC comes down to scale, rooftop packaged units, three-phase power, and code requirements homes never face.
How Much Does Commercial HVAC Maintenance Cost?
Commercial HVAC maintenance cost in DFW depends on unit count, tonnage, and cadence, but runs 3-5x cheaper than emergency repairs. Here's how to size your budget.
How Often Should a Commercial Rooftop Unit Be Serviced?
Rooftop unit service frequency for DFW commercial HVAC: 2-4 visits/year standard, more for restaurants, multi-tenant, or 24/7 buildings.
